Bentley Systems, Incorporated (NASDAQ:BSY - Get Free Report) has received a consensus rating of "Moderate Buy" from the ten analysts that are covering the company, Marketbeat Ratings reports. One equities research analyst has rated the stock with a sell recommendation, two have given a hold recommendation and seven have given a buy recommendation to the company. The average 1-year price objective among brokers that have covered the stock in the last year is $52.00.
Several equities analysts recently weighed in on the company. JPMorgan Chase & Co. lowered their target price on Bentley Systems from $52.00 to $45.00 and set a "neutral" rating on the stock in a research report on Wednesday, April 9th. Robert W. Baird lowered their target price on Bentley Systems from $60.00 to $59.00 and set an "outperform" rating on the stock in a research report on Thursday, February 27th. UBS Group boosted their price objective on Bentley Systems from $48.00 to $53.00 and gave the company a "neutral" rating in a research report on Thursday, May 8th. Mizuho lowered their price objective on Bentley Systems from $60.00 to $50.00 and set an "outperform" rating on the stock in a research report on Tuesday, April 15th. Finally, Oppenheimer boosted their price objective on Bentley Systems from $49.00 to $50.00 and gave the company an "outperform" rating in a research report on Thursday, May 8th.

Bentley Systems Stock Performance
NASDAQ BSY traded down $1.96 on Friday, hitting $47.79. 1,773,953 shares of the company traded hands, compared to its average volume of 1,221,806. The company has a market capitalization of $13.95 billion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 43.05, a P/E/G ratio of 3.52 and a beta of 1.07. The company has a current ratio of 0.52, a quick ratio of 0.52 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 1.37. The business's 50 day moving average price is $44.93 and its 200-day moving average price is $45.46. Bentley Systems has a 52-week low of $36.51 and a 52-week high of $52.42.
Bentley Systems (NASDAQ:BSY - Get Free Report) last released its earnings results on Wednesday, May 7th. The company reported $0.35 earnings per share for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of $0.30 by $0.05. The company had revenue of $370.54 million for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$366.76 million. Bentley Systems had a return on equity of 29.50% and a net margin of 27.73%. Bentley Systems's quarterly revenue was up 9.7%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same period in the previous year, the business earned $0.31 earnings per share. Equities analysts expect that Bentley Systems will post 0.88 earnings per share for the current year.
Bentley Systems Dividend Announcement
The business also recently disclosed a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Thursday, June 12th. Stockholders of record on Tuesday, June 3rd will be paid a $0.07 dividend. This represents a $0.28 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 0.59%. The ex-dividend date of this dividend is Tuesday, June 3rd. Bentley Systems's payout ratio is 35.44%.

About Bentley Systems
(
Get Free ReportBentley Systems, Incorporated, together with its subsidiaries, provides infrastructure engineering software solutions in the Americas, Europe, the Middle East, Africa, and the Asia-Pacific. The company offers open modeling engineering applications, such as MicroStation, OpenBridge, OpenBuildings, OpenCities, OpenComms, OpenFlows, OpenPlant, OpenRail, OpenRoads, OpenSite, OpenTower, OpenTunnel, OpenUtilities, and OpenWindowPower; and open simulation engineering applications, including ADINA, AutoPIPE, CUBE, DYNAMEQ, EMME, LEGION, Power Line Systems, RAM, SACS, SPIDA, and STAAD; and geoprofessional applications for modeling and simulation of near and deep subsurface conditions, including AGS, Central, GeoStudio, Imago, Leapfrog, MX Deposit, Oasis montaj, OpenGround, and PLAXIS.
